- Acer pensylvanicum Linnaeus, Species Plantarum 2: 1055. 1753. "Habitat in Pensylvania. Kalm." RCN: 7639. Lectotype (Murray in Kalmia 7: 9. 1975): Kalm, Herb. Linn. No. 1225.13 (LINN; iso- UPS). Current name: Acer pensylvanicum L. (Aceraceae).
